-/*----------------------------- Intel Hex format -----------------------------*/
-
-/*
- * Intel Hex data-record layout
- *
- * :aabbbbccd...dee
- *
- * : - header character
- * aa - record data byte count, a 2-digit hex value
- * bbbb - record address, a 4-digit hex value
- * cc - record type, a 2-digit hex value:
- * "00" is a data record
- * "01" is an end-of-data record
- * "02" is an extended-address record
- * "03" is a start record
- * d...d - data (always an even number of chars)
- * ee - record checksum, a 2-digit hex value
- * checksum = 2's complement
- * [ (sum of bytes: aabbbbccd...d) modulo 256 ]
- */
-
-
-Boolean is_intel_data_rec( char * rec_str )
-{
- return( ( rec_str[ 0 ] == ':' ) && ( rec_str[ 8 ] == '0' ) );
-}
-
-Uint get_intel_rec_data_count( char * rec_str )
-{
- return( ( Uint ) get_ndigit_hex( rec_str + 1, 2 ) );
-}
-
-Ulong get_intel_rec_address( char * rec_str )
-{
- return( get_ndigit_hex( rec_str + 3, 4 ) );
-}
-
-char * get_intel_rec_data_start( char * rec_str )
-{
- return( rec_str + 9 );
-}
-
-void put_intel_data_rec( Uint count, Ulong address, char * data_str )
-{
- char *ptr;
- Uint sum = count + ( address >> 8 & 0xff ) + ( address & 0xff );
-
- for ( ptr = data_str ; *ptr != EOS ; ptr += 2 )
- sum += ( Uint ) get_ndigit_hex( ptr, 2 );
-
- printf(
- ":%02X%04lX00%s%02X\n", count, address, data_str, (~sum + 1) & 0xff
- );
-}
-
-
-Rec_vitals intel_hex =
-{
- is_intel_data_rec,
- get_intel_rec_address,
- get_intel_rec_data_count,
- 255, /* Maximum data bytes in a record. */
- get_intel_rec_data_start,
- put_intel_data_rec
-};
-
-
-/*------------------------- Motorola S1-record format ------------------------*/
-
-/*
- * Motorola S-record data-record layout
- *
- * Sabbc...cd...dee
- *
- * S - header character
- * a - record type, a 1-digit value:
- * "0" is a header record
- * "1" is a 2-byte-address data record
- * "2" is a 3-byte-address data record
- * "3" is a 4-byte-address data record
- * "7" is a 4-byte-address end-of-data record
- * "8" is a 3-byte-address end-of-data record
- * "9" is a 2-byte-address end-of-data record
- * bb - record length in bytes, a 2-digit hex value
- * (record length doesn't count the header/type
- * chars and checksum byte)
- * c...c - record address, a 4-, 6-, or 8-digit value,
- * depending on record type
- * d...d - data (always an even number of chars)
- * ee - record checksum, a 2-digit hex value
- * checksum = 1's complement
- * [ (sum of all bytes: bbc..cd...d) modulo 256 ]
- */

-/*
- * unhex
- * convert a hex file to binary equivalent. If more than one file name
- * is given, then the output will be logically concatenated together.
- * stdin and stdout are defaults. Verbose will enable checksum output.
- *
- * Supported input formats are Intel hex, Motorola S records, and TI 'B'
- * records.
- *
- * Intel hex input format is
- * Byte
- * 1 Colon :
- * 2..3 Record length, eg: "20"
- * 4..7 load address nibbles
- * 8..9 record type: "00" (data) or "02" base addr
- * 10..x data bytes in ascii-hex
- * x+1..x+2 cksum (2's compl of (len+addr+data))
- * x+3 \n -- newline
- *
- * $Id$
- */
